Как работает интернет: от требования до скачивания страниц
Каждый сутки миллионы людей открывают браузеры и получают доступность к данным. Процесс загрузки веб-страницы кажется быстрым, но за этим скрывается последовательность технологических действий. Она содержит преобразование адреса казино, создание связи с отдалённым компьютером, передачу данных и вывод контента. Осмысление этих стадий содействует осознать, как организована мировая сеть.
Что происходит в момент, когда набирается адрес сайта
Пользователь вводит адрес в строку браузера и жмёт клавишу ввода. Браузер начинает обрабатывание требования с разбора внесённой строки. Приложение проверяет, является ли текст правильным адресом или поисковым обращением. Если строка имеет точки и подходит шаблону веб-адреса, браузер интерпретирует её как URL.
После выявления вида требования браузер анализирует адрес на составные элементы. Адрес включает протокол передачи сведений, доменное имя и путь к странице. Протокол указывает способ обмена информацией. Доменное имя являет символьное название источника в сети.
Браузер контролирует личную память на существование кэшированных информации о ресурсе. Кэш может хранить копии файлов, что ускоряет скачивание. Если данные релевантна, браузер использует кэшированные данные. 10 лучших казино онлайн зависит от конфигурации кэширования и периода финального обращения к ресурсу.
Как система доменных имён способствует найти необходимый сервер
Компьютеры в сети передают информацией, используя числовые адреса. Человеку сложно запоминать последовательности цифр, поэтому была создана система доменных имён. Эта система преобразует символьные имена в числовые коды, ясные сетевым оборудованию.
Когда браузер извлекает доменное имя, он обращается к специальным серверам DNS. Обращение идёт через несколько ступеней. Корневые серверы направляют обращение к серверам зон верхнего уровня. Те отправляют запрос к авторитетным серверам конкретного домена.
Авторитетный сервер выдаёт числовой адрес запрашиваемого ресурса. Браузер записывает сведения в локальном кэше. При последующем запросе браузер применяет сохранённые данные, что уменьшает длительность процесса. онлайн казино выполняется за фракции секунды, но включает множество промежуточных этапов между различными серверами.
Связь между адресом сайта и численным адресом устройства
Доменное имя служит комфортным названием для пользователей. Цифровой адрес представляет неповторимый код устройства в сети. Система DNS создаёт соответствие между текстовым названием и числовым значением. Один домен может соответствовать нескольким адресам, если ресурс находится на различных серверах. Такая архитектура обеспечивает стабильность деятельности сетевых служб.
Формирование соединения: как устройства обмениваются командами
После получения численного адреса браузер запускает связь с сервером. Устройства делятся выделенными импульсами для установления канала связи. Клиент отправляет обращение на подключение. Сервер получает обращение и посылает уведомление готовности к передаче сведениями.
Клиент получает подтверждение и передаёт финальный команду. Этот трёхфазный процесс именуется рукопожатием. Механизм обеспечивает готовность двух сторон к передаче информации. После завершения создаётся устойчивый путь для передачи информацией.
Для защищённых связей осуществляются дополнительные действия. Устройства согласовывают характеристики шифрования и передают ключами. Сервер передаёт цифровой сертификат. 10 лучших казино онлайн проверяет сертификат и устанавливает зашифрованный канал, защищающий сведения от кражи.
Пересылка сведений: как данные движется от сервера к клиенту
После создания соединения запускается передача данных. Браузер отправляет HTTP-запрос, включающий данные о запрашиваемом ресурсе. Запрос включает метод взаимодействия, адрес к файлу и дополнительные характеристики. Сервер анализирует требование и генерирует ответ.
Информация отправляются небольшими частями, именуемыми пакетами. Каждый пакет включает часть данных и вспомогательные сведения для маршрутизации. Пакеты следуют через ряд посреднических узлов сети. Маршрутизаторы перенаправляют пакеты к адресату, определяя наилучшие пути.
Клиент объединяет пакеты в верном порядке и проверяет сохранность информации. Если пакеты утеряны или повреждены, требуется новая передача. онлайн казино обеспечивает надёжную пересылку информации. Протоколы передачи управляют быстроту передачи, приспосабливаясь к пропускной возможности пути связи.
Почему защищенное связь представляет важность
Криптование защищает сведения от неразрешённого доступа. Хакеры не могут прочитать криптованную данные при перехвате. Безопасное связь казино онлайн верифицирует достоверность сервера. Пользователи могут надёжно пересылать приватные данные и финансовую данные.
Сервер и его ответ: как формируется содержимое страницы
Сервер получает требование от браузера и стартует обработку. Программное обеспечение изучает путь к искомому ресурсу. Если запрашивается фиксированный файл, сервер получает его из дисковой системы. Фиксированные файлы содержат графику, таблицы стилей и готовые документы.
Для интерактивных страниц сервер запускает программный код. Код апеллирует к репозиториям сведений для приёма релевантной данных. Сервер компонует данные из разных хранилищ и формирует HTML-документ. Процесс формирования зависит от сложности запроса и количества данных.
После формирования наполнения сервер генерирует HTTP-ответ. Отклик охватывает код статуса, заголовки и содержимое сообщения. Заголовки содержат служебные данные о передаваемом содержимом. казино онлайн передаёт подготовленный реакцию обратно получателю по сформированному соединению.
Из чего состоит веб-страница
Веб-страница составляет собой набор разных файлов и элементов. Фундамент составляет HTML-документ, определяющий организацию и наполнение. HTML использует теги для форматирования текста, заголовков и иных компонентов. Документ содержит отсылки на дополнительные компоненты.
Таблицы стилей CSS обеспечивают за визуальное представление страницы. Стили определяют окраску, шрифты, величины и позиционирование элементов. Один файл стилей может использоваться к массе страниц. JavaScript привносит интерактивность и активное действие. Скрипты анализируют операции юзера и трансформируют контент без рефреша.
Изображения, видео и аудиофайлы расширяют письменное наполнение. Шрифты могут загружаться отдельно для требуемого представления текста. 10 лучших казино онлайн требует все нужные элементы после приёма главного HTML-документа, формируя целостную изображение страницы.
Как браузер обрабатывает и выводит содержимое
Браузер извлекает HTML-документ и приступает грамматический разбор. Приложение построчно обрабатывает код и создаёт иерархическую структуру частей. Эта архитектура зовётся объектной моделью документа. Каждый тег превращается элементом дерева, связанным с родительскими и подчинёнными узлами.
Одновременно браузер обрабатывает таблицы стилей. Программа применяет правила стилизации к подходящим частям. Определяются габариты, позиции и зрительные параметры каждого блока. Браузер создаёт структуру визуализации, соединяющее структуру и стилизацию.
На следующем шаге происходит расстановка компонентов. Браузер вычисляет точные координаты и величины каждого компонента. После финализации подсчётов начинается рендеринг. онлайн казино выводит точки на дисплей, создавая видимое представление. При подгрузке добавочных компонентов браузер перерисовывает визуализацию.
Функция организации страницы, оформления и интерактивных частей
HTML задаёт структурную структуру контента и иерархию частей. CSS обеспечивает визуальную красоту и усиливает восприятие данных. JavaScript обеспечивает отклик на операции юзера. Комбинация трёх инструментов формирует функциональные веб-интерфейсы. Обособление организации онлайн казино, дизайна и поведения ускоряет разработку порталов.
Почему быстрота загрузки страниц может различаться
Темп загрузки зависит от множества обстоятельств. Транспортная возможность интернет-соединения влияет на период пересылки данных. Низкоскоростное связь увеличивает время загрузки файлов. Дистанция между клиентом и сервером также несёт значение. Чем удалённее размещён сервер, тем продолжительнее времени необходимо для прохождения импульса.
Объём и число компонентов на странице влияют на общее время загрузки. Страницы с массой картинок и скриптов подгружаются продолжительнее. Улучшение файлов уменьшает объём передаваемых информации. Уменьшение картинок и минимизация кода убыстряют загрузку.
Производительность сервера определяет быстроту обработки запросов. Загруженный сервер неторопливее генерирует реакции. казино онлайн может ощущать замедления при большой нагрузке. Качество маршрутизации воздействует на период транспортировки пакетов.
Сохранение информации и разделение трафика: как увеличивается доступ к порталам
Для увеличения доступности применяются структуры кэширования. Переходные серверы сохраняют копии часто запрашиваемых элементов. Когда пользователь обращается к ресурсу, запрос анализируется ближайшим кэширующим сервером. Это сокращает дистанцию передачи данных и понижает загрузку.
Сети распространения содержимого хранят дубликаты компонентов на серверах по всему миру. Пользователи получают сведения от географически ближайшего узла. Такая архитектура минимизирует торможения и увеличивает темп подгрузки. Размещение наполнения результативно для статических файлов: изображений, стилей и скриптов.
Балансировщики загрузки разделяют запросы между несколькими серверами. Если один сервер перегружен, требования направляются к меньше свободным машинам. казино онлайн обеспечивает надёжную работу при высоком потоке. Дублирование увеличивает надёжность: при сбое одного сервера обращения отправляются к работающим серверам.
Как манипуляции пользователя сказываются на подгрузку страницы
Операции клиента прямо сказываются на ход скачивания. Клик по ссылке порождает свежий требование к серверу. Браузер возобновляет цикл: преобразование адреса, формирование подключения и приём данных. Внесение форм и передача данных создают вспомогательные запросы.
Скроллинг страницы может инициировать загрузку дополнительных элементов. Технология ленивой подгрузки подгружает картинки по мере потребности. Такой способ повышает первоначальную скачивание и сберегает трафик. Интерактивные элементы откликаются на движения указателя, выполняя скрипты и трансформируя наполнение.
Настройки браузера воздействуют на поведение при скачивании. Деактивация JavaScript останавливает выполнение скриптов. Блокировщики рекламы останавливают загрузку конкретных элементов. 10 лучших казино онлайн может сохранять предпочтения юзера, влияющие на показ наполнения и быстроту работы портала.